Dukal 7011 - Aluminum Tuning Fork, 256c, with Fixed Weights

The Dukal 7011 Aluminum Tuning Fork is a precision instrument designed to produce a consistent 256 cycles per second (256c) vibration frequency. Constructed from durable, nonmagnetic aluminum, it includes fixed weights at the prongs for enhanced resonance and sustained tone duration. This tuning fork is used by healthcare professionals to evaluate hearing acuity, detect bone fractures, and assess neurological function. Its high quality construction ensures dependable performance and long term durability in clinical and educational environments.

Usage Guidelines

To use, hold the tuning fork by the stem and strike one prong gently against a rubber mallet or a firm but nonmetallic surface to initiate vibration. Place the vibrating fork near the desired test area, such as over the bone or near the ear, to assess the patient's response. Avoid striking the fork on hard or metallic objects, as this can affect calibration and sound clarity. After each use, clean with a mild disinfectant and dry thoroughly before storage.

Best Practices for Use and Maintenance

Handle the tuning fork carefully to maintain calibration and tone accuracy. Always strike with a non-metallic object to avoid denting or altering the frequency. Clean after each use and store in a protective case to prevent damage. Periodically check for signs of wear, corrosion, or frequency deviation, and replace if the tone changes noticeably. Proper maintenance ensures long-term precision and safe diagnostic performance.
